Abstract
Based on the common Hermite-Gaussian modes, a general class of orthonormal sets of Hermite-Gaussian-type modes is introduced. Such modes can most easily be defined by means of their generating function. It is shown that these modes remain in their class of orthonormal Hermite-Gaussian-type modes, when they propagate through first-order optical systems. A propagation law for the generating function is formulated.
